Keeping Your Pillows Clean
Now that you are aware of the significance of maintaining clean pillows, let’s move on to practical cleaning methods. To get your pillows back to their former splendor, just follow these easy steps:

1. Verify that your pillow can be machine washed safely by reading the care label. You can wash most pillows this way, especially ones that are filled with feathers or polyester.

2. If your pillow is machine-washable, load a couple into the washer, being careful not to fill it to the brim. This guarantees that there will be adequate water circulation to clean them completely.

3. Fill the machine with half a cup of bleach and a mild detergent. In addition to killing any bacteria or mites that might be hiding in your cushions, bleach can assist get rid of tough stains. White vinegar can be used in place of bleach if you’d rather take a more organic approach.

4. Use warm water and a gentle cycle in the washing machine. It’s better to use warm water instead of hot as hot water can harm some kinds of pillows.

5. Give the pillows one more rinse after the washing cycle is finished to make sure all the

Bleach and detergent are completely eliminated.

6. Refer to the care label recommendations for your pillows to dry them. On a low heat setting, the majority of pillows are safe to tumble dry. To guarantee even drying, add a few dryer balls or clean tennis balls to the dryer to help fluff up the pillows.

7. To ensure that your pillows are completely dry and free of clumps, give them a good fluff and squeeze once they’ve dried.

And that’s it! You can efficiently clean your unclean pillows, restoring their whiteness and creating a healthier sleeping environment, by following these easy steps.
